Fuel Pressure
 
does anyone know what the stock fuel pressure is on an LS motor. i have an adjustable pressure regulator and need an idea of what to set it to. i'd like to bump up the fuel pressure a bit, whats a good setting if i only have intake and exhaust? also is there any cheap alternative to the B&M pressure gauge i can't justify spending $45 on a gauge like that. i hear that princess auto sells similar gauges for like $10 just gotta re-tap the treads to fit metric

Stock fuel pressure slightly varies on each car, but roughly around 40-45psi with vacuum hose disconnected.

GSR w/vacuum connected = 38 - 46psi
w/ vacuum disconnected = 47 - 55psi

Civic B16a2 w/ vacuum connected = 30 - 37psi
w/ vacuum disconnected = 40 - 47ps

LS b18b1 w/ vacuum connected = 31 - 36psi
w/ vacuum disconnected = 40 - 47psi

CRV b20b w/ vacuum connected = 30 - 37psi
w/ vacuum disconnected = 38 - 46psi

CRV b20z w/ vacuum connected = 31 - 38psi
w/ vacuum disconnected = 40 - 47psi
